THTR 201 - Costume Design I

(3 units)
Introduction to the principles, elements and practicalities of costume design. Curriculum and projects will focus on script analysis, research, rendering techniques, organization, development of concept and presentation of designs.

Maximum units a student may earn: 3

Prerequisite(s): THTR 208  or THTR 235  .

Grading Basis: Graded
Units of Lecture: 2
Units of Laboratory/Studio: 1
Offered: Every Fall - Odd Years

Student Learning Outcomes
Upon completion of this course, students will be able to:
1. define the role of a costume designer as a part of the production team.
2. learn and be able to effectively use costume design and technology terminology.
3. successfully analyze a script from multiple viewpoints.
4. translate historical, technical and emotional research into working designs.
5. create a show concept based on text, creativity and research.
